发表评论取消回复
相关阅读
相关 什么是 Python 中的装饰器?
装饰器是Python中最强大的设计模式之一。装饰器用于向已创建的对象添加新功能,而无需修改其结构。使用装饰器,您可以轻松包装另一个函数以扩展包装的函数行为,并且无需永久修改即可
相关 代理模式和装饰器模式有什么区别?
代理模式和装饰器模式都是面向对象编程中的设计模式,它们在功能上有一些相似之处,但也有一些关键的区别。 代理模式是一种保护对象免受意外变化的影响,即控制对另一个对象的访问。在代
相关 装饰器模式是什么
装饰器模式(Decorator Pattern)是一种结构型设计模式,它允许你在不改变类结构的情况下,动态地给一个对象增加新的功能。装饰器模式通过在运行时动态地给一个对象添加新
相关 Python中的装饰器是什么?装饰器是如何工作的?
Python很早就引入了装饰器——在PEP-318中,作为一种简化函数和方法定义方式的机制,这些函数和方法在初始定义之后必须进行修改。 这样做的最初动机之一是,使用class
相关 什么是装饰模式以及装饰模式的使用场景
装饰模式(Decorator):装饰模式可以在不修改对象外观和功能的情况下添加或者删除对象功能。它可以使用一种对客户端来说透明的方法来修改对象的功能,也就是使用初始类的子类实例
相关 什么是装饰模式
![在这里插入图片描述][watermark_type_ZmFuZ3poZW5naGVpdGk_shadow_10_text_aHR0cHM6Ly9ibG9nLmNzZG4ub
相关 装饰模式
有抽象类名为早餐,现在具体的食物只需继承早餐抽象类,就可以作为早餐。 具体构件类,如只有breakfast抽象类和Hamburger类,满足需求。 如果需求改变,hamb
还没有评论,来说两句吧...